My morning workouts have been frustrating lately.  I usually roll out of bed and hit the gym – no question, just habit.  However, I’ve been laying in a bed lately debating with myself.

If I sleep in now, I can just do some stretching on my lunch break…. If it doesn’t rain later, I can get an outdoor walk in after work instead of a treadmill one this morning… I probably don’t NEED to work out as often, do I?…

You get the idea.  What’s up with all this dialogue?  Why the change?  Thank goodness, I’ve still been getting it done, and 90% of the time, once I actually get my butt to the gym, I have a pretty fabulous workout.  (kinda like my hilly 5k walk yesterday)

workout

But I suppose we all have times of motivation peak and pitfall, eh?  I’ve already written a post on motivation, so there’s no need to re-hash all that.  But I can say that what’s working for me now is just telling myself to go and give it 20 minutes.  Promise to give 20 minutes, and I bet you’ll probably end up completing a full (or nearly full) and stellar workout.

Here’s the plan that I’ve been half following for the past two weeks.  I plan to continue it for the next two or three weeks (including this week).  It has some fellow blogger inspiration, and I like it so far!

workout

I’m a leg day ninja!

Though I mix up the sets and reps, many are often completed at 3 or 4 sets of 8 reps.

Monday – shoulders/triceps

  • military press
  • lateral DB raise
  • front DB raise
  • overhead DB triceps extension
  • bench dips
  • triceps machine
  • swim or elliptical

Tuesday – abs

Wednesday – chest/biceps

  • Laura’s Workout (check out her page for the details)
  • long treadmill walk with incline

Thursday – lower body

Friday – back

Saturday/Sunday

  • long walk with the hubby and active rest (ie: cleaning, yard work, etc.)
